Charles Dethevo, Doug Mandel, Margaret Widdowson, and Bev Jennings, members of the California Native Plant Society, Shasta Chapter, and Ghost Pine Native Plant Nursery, respectively, were among the participants hosting the 55th annual Shasta College Horticulture Department Spring Plant Sale, held on Friday and Saturday, April 3 and 4, 2026, on the Shasta College campus.

The event, held on the campus' College Farm, was organized and staffed by the Shasta College Horticulture Club and featured many hard-to-find plants that have proven to grow well in the Shasta County area, with all proceeds going to fund scholarships, as well as providing financial support for the Shasta College Horticulture Club program.

Visitors to Shasta College's 55th annual Horticulture Department Spring Plant Sale, including Maicynne Ankemy, Leah Beeson, Amber Castillo, Abby Castillo, Dennis Custis, Macy Dambacher, Serena Elwood, Kacie Finn, Brenna Long, Sarah Roth, Angel Sams, Jerry Sanchez, Sr. and Grace Tousdale, were able to purchase annuals for bedding, cut flowers, perennials, herbs, succulents a wide variety of vegetable starts, plus trees, shrubs, California native plants and houseplants.

According to Leimone Waite, horticulture instructor at Shasta College, all plants that were available for sale were sustainably grown by horticulture students on the College Farm. Additionally, horticulture students have started growing a diverse selection of Certified Organic vegetable plants.
